GSA OIG Employees Recognized at 2014 IG Awards Ceremony

U.S. General Services Administration (GSA) Office of Inspector General (OIG) employees, along with others, were recognized today at the 17th annual inspector general awards ceremony, hosted by the Council of Inspectors General on Integrity and Efficiency (CIGIE).

GSA OIG special agents and counsel staff received Awards for Excellence for their work on the Trusted Agent and Science Applications International investigative case, which resulted in a $5.75 million settlement, as well as the Naval Air Station North Island bribery case investigation, which resulted in several convictions.
